Excerpt from The Story of Two Wars: An Illustrated History of Our War With Spain and Our War With the Filipinos; Their Causes, Incidents, and Results; A Record of Civil, Military, and Naval Operations From Official Sources Of General Lee I need say but little. His valuable services to his country in his trying position are too well known to all his countrymen to require mention. Besides his ability, high character, and courage, he possesses the impor tant requisites of unfailing tact and courtesy, and, withal, his military education and training and his soldierly qualities are invaluable adjuncts in the equipment of our representative in a country so completely under military rule as was Cuba. General Lee kindly invited us to Sit at his table at the hotel during our stay in Havana, and this opportunity for frequent informal talks with him was of great help to me. Excerpt from The Story of Our War With Spain In this story of our war with Spain no attempt has been made to enter upon a discussion of methods or an elaborate plan of campaign. The author's design has been to give simply, concisely, and connectedly the complete story of what President McKinley calls "our extraordinary war with Spain," so that readers, young and old, who have neither time nor inclination for the study of operations in too great detail may obtain, as it were, a bird's-eye view of the war from the insistent causes to the final triumphal close. Besides Mr. Emerson's spirited drawings, the publishers were able to procure from one of the "boys" actually at the front "snap shots" of prominent scenes and places that add a distinctive value to the story, and make privation, action, and environment even more real than could a mere "hearsay" sketch.
